    Then, How can I arrange my room without a fireplace?

    Pull furniture pieces closer together. Having couches and chairs near one another encourages conversation and creates a sense of intimacy. If you don’t change anything else in your room, the addition of throws or blankets will instantly warm up your space. Paint a wall or the entire room in a softer or darker color.

    Does a couch have to be centered in front of TV?

    Whether you decide to set the TV on a console or mount it on the wall, the best height for a TV is actually the same – eye level for a person sitting on the sofa. In general, that means the center of the TV should be about 42” above the floor, regardless of the size of the TV.

    How do you coordinate chairs and couches?

    The seat height of your sofa and chairs should be within 4″ of each other, if not less. That means if the seat height of your chair is 17″ your seat height of your sofa should be as close as possible to that (ideally no shorter than 14″ and no taller than 20″).

    How far should your sofa be from TV?

    A general guideline is to sit between 1.5 to 2.5 times the diagonal screen measurement away, with about a 30-degree viewing angle. For example, if you have a 40″ TV, you should be sitting somewhere between 5 and 8.3 feet from the screen.

    How can a focal point be created in a room by using a mirror?

    You can also use a statement mirror to create a focal point. Mirrors are pretty strategic pieces. They’re decorative, functional, and bounce light around to make a room feel brighter and more open. To use a mirror as a focal point, think about its frame, size, and where you would hang it (what will it reflect?).

    How do you not make a TV a focal point?

    Place the TV in an off-center position

    1. First, rearrange furniture so that couches and chairs face each other, not the TV.
    2. Then, move the TV to an off-center position of the room or wall.
    3. Lastly, consider drawing the eye by centering a large art piece where the television was.

    Can you land on Saturn?

    Surface. As a gas giant, Saturn doesn’t have a true surface. The planet is mostly swirling gases and liquids deeper down. While a spacecraft would have nowhere to land on Saturn, it wouldn’t be able to fly through unscathed either.

    Does moon have oxygen?

    Although the Moon does have an atmosphere, it’s very thin and composed mostly of hydrogen, neon and argon. … That said, there is actually plenty of oxygen on the Moon. It just isn’t in a gaseous form. Instead it’s trapped inside regolith — the layer of rock and fine dust that covers the Moon’s surface.

    Earlier in the movie, the father won a ‘leg lamp’ as an award. The following is after the mother accidentally breaks it. Father: Don’t you touch that! You were always jealous of this lamp.

    Then, Did flick really stick his tongue?

    In the 1983 holiday classic “A Christmas Story,” his character, Flick, acted on a triple-dog dare, sticking his tongue to the school flagpole. Fortunately, the 14-year-old actor’s tongue wasn’t really “thtuck,” and no children were harmed filming the scene.

    Secondly, What will happen in 1 billion years? In about one billion years, the solar luminosity will be 10% higher than at present. This will cause the atmosphere to become a “moist greenhouse”, resulting in a runaway evaporation of the oceans. As a likely consequence, plate tectonics will come to an end, and with them the entire carbon cycle.

    What if Earth had ring?

    Earth’s hypothetical rings would differ in one key way from Saturn’s; they wouldn’t have ice. Earth lies much closer to the sun than Saturn does, so radiation from our star would cause any ice in Earth’s rings to sublime away. Still, even if Earth’s rings were made of rock, that might not mean they would look dark.

    How big of a telescope do I need to see the flag on the moon?

    The flag on the moon is 125cm (4 feet) long. You would require a telescope around 200 meters in diameter to see it. The largest telescope now is the Keck Telescope in Hawaii at 10 meters in diameter. Even the Hubble Space telescope is only 2.4 meters in diameter.

    How big a telescope do I need to see Jupiter?

    A well-made 5-inch refractor or 6-inch reflector on a sturdy tracking mount is really about the minimum for serious Jupiter observing. Larger instruments will allow scrutiny of fine detail and subtle low-contrast markings.

    How big of a telescope do you need to see Neptune?

    Neptune’s disk is visible at 200× through a 6-inch telescope on a night of steady seeing. But it may be quite hard to see the disk if conditions are bad or your telescope is improperly collimated.

    What is la misa de gallo?

    Misa de Gallo (Spanish for “Rooster’s Mass“, also Misa de los Pastores, “Shepherds’ Mass;” Portuguese: Missa do Galo; Catalan: Missa del gall) is a name for the Catholic Mass celebrated around midnight of Christmas Eve and sometimes in the days immediately preceding Christmas.

    What do Spanish do on Christmas Day?

    Most people in Spain go to Midnight Mass or ‘La Misa Del Gallo’ (The Mass of the Rooster). It is called this because a rooster is supposed to have crowed the night that Jesus was born.

    Why do Spanish eat 12 grapes?

    las doce uvas de la suerte, “the twelve grapes of luck”) is a Spanish tradition that consists of eating a grape with each clock bell strike at midnight of December 31 to welcome the New Year. … According to the tradition, eating the twelve grapes leads to a year of good luck and prosperity.

    What are the three kings names in Spanish?

    As you may know the Three Kings, Balthasar (Spanish = Baltasar), Gaspar and Melchior (Spanish = Melchor) arrived twelve days after the birth of Jesus, bearing their famous gifts of gold, and frankincense and myrrh.

    How much do Hallmark movies cost to make?

    To maximize their $2 million budget, most Hallmark Channel holiday features are shot in Canada, where tax breaks can stretch the dollar. Wintry Vancouver is a popular destination, though films have also been shot in Montreal and Toronto.

    What are the 4 types of conjunctions?

    There are four kinds of conjunctions: coordinating conjunctions, correlative conjunctions, subordinating conjunctions, and conjunctive adverbs.

    How do you remember subordinating conjunctions?

    One handy mnemonic for the subordinate conjunctions is “on a white bus”:

    1. O = only if, once.
    2. N = now that.
    3. A = although, after, as.
    4. WH = while, when, whereas, whenever, wherever, whether.
    5. H = how.
    6. I = if, in case, in order that.
    7. T = though.
    8. E = even though, even if.
